Edith Bowman hails from Anstruther, Scotland. She worked in her parents hotel before going to college and studying for a degree in Communication Studies at Edinburgh's Queen Margaret College. For the following two years Edith worked in a local radio station as both a producer and presenter.
Edith joined Radio 1 in 2003 and her first show for the network was the Colin and Edith show with Colin Murray. Since 2006 she has flown solo with her weekday show 13:00 - 16:00. She described coming to Radio 1 as a "Childhood Dream," She's a massive music fan and fanatical gig goer and prior to working with BBC Radio1 co presented MTV's Hitlist UK with Cat Deeley.
A wide and varied career Edith has travelled to Cambodia as part of BBC’s series Saving Planet Earth, hosted the Scottish Baftas and co- presented Live Earth alongside Graham Norton and Jonathan Ross. She’s as at home interviewing the likes of Liam Gallagher, Muse, Robbie Williams, Kylie and U2, to presenting BBC2's Rough Guide To The World, Channel 4's breakfast show RISE, and regular film specials for Channel 4 and ITV. She is the yearly host of the BBC's coverage of Glastonbury, Reading and Leeds festival, T In The Park, Radio 1’s One Big Weekends and the Electric Proms.
In 2005 Edith won Celebrity Fame Academy for Comic Relief.
